Party Orders 3 Days of Autumn Training

The North Korean authorities have ordered the armed forces and civilians to attend three days of anti-aircraft and battle training exercises, Daily NK has learned. The reason behind the training, which runs from the 29th to the 31st, is unclear, but it may be a precaution against social unrest while senior officers are in Pyongyang.

An inside source from North Hamkyung Province told Daily NK on the 30th, “This order came down from the Party Central Military Commission entitled, ‘On beginning training for the army and people.’ Currently, soldiers are doing anti-aircraft training and people have been mobilized for evacuations.”

“This is not like that training we had in the spring, where everyone was out on full combat mobilization,” the source acknowledged. However, “We don’t know the reason why they suddenly ordered everyone out for autumn training like this. It’s unusual, so people are puzzled.”

“The Central Party ordered that the training should last for three days from the 29th. People are complaining amongst themselves because they have no idea why they need to be mobilized from 5 in the morning until late at night,” the she went on.

Although the logic behind the move is unclear, the source said there is the possibility that the central military authorities ordered the training sessions because they were concerned that base discipline might be lost after ranking officers and political commissars were called to Pyongyang for military meetings.

“In this training there are these slogans that say, ‘We must accept the sole leadership of the Marshal [Kim Jong Eun],’” the source said. “Also, there have been lectures telling us that ‘If we all unite behind the Party there is nothing we can’t do.’”

However, “In reality, people have little interest in these exercises and can’t see the point of them. They’re only doing it because they’ve been told to do it by the Upper [Central Party], but they are much more concerned about quickly getting back to work.”
